Strategies for Developing and Implementing Effective Diversity and Inclusion Initiatives

Developing and implementing effective diversity and inclusion (D&I) initiatives requires a strategic and comprehensive approach that goes beyond mere compliance. Organizations that are committed should consider these strategies for developing and implementing effective diversity and inclusion initiatives.

Strategies for Developing and Implementing Effective Diversity and Inclusion Initiatives

  1. Leadership Commitment:

    • Visible Leadership Support: Leaders should visibly champion diversity and inclusion initiatives, communicating a commitment to fostering an inclusive workplace culture.
    • Integration into Organizational Values: Embed diversity and inclusion into the organization’s core values, ensuring that it is a fundamental aspect of the organizational culture.
  2. Assessment and Benchmarking:

    • Assess Current State: Conduct a thorough assessment of the organization’s current diversity and inclusion landscape, including demographic data, employee perceptions, and existing policies.
    • Benchmarking: Compare your organization’s diversity metrics and practices with industry benchmarks to identify areas for improvement and set realistic goals.
  3. Establish Clear Goals and Metrics:

    • Specific and Measurable Goals: Define clear and specific diversity and inclusion goals that are measurable. These goals may include increasing the representation of underrepresented groups, improving inclusion scores, or reducing biases in hiring and promotion processes.
    • Regular Monitoring: Set up a system to regularly monitor and measure progress toward diversity and inclusion goals.
  4. Employee Involvement and Feedback:

    • Employee Resource Groups (ERGs): Establish ERGs that provide a platform for employees to share their experiences, connect with others, and contribute to diversity and inclusion initiatives.
    • Surveys and Focus Groups: Conduct surveys and focus groups to gather employee feedback on diversity and inclusion efforts. Use this input to refine and tailor initiatives based on the unique needs of your workforce.
  5. Diversity Training and Education:

    • Mandatory Training: Implement mandatory diversity and inclusion training for all employees, including leadership. Focus on topics such as unconscious bias, cultural competence, and fostering an inclusive work environment.
    • Continuous Learning: Provide ongoing educational opportunities to reinforce diversity and inclusion principles and keep employees informed about current issues and best practices.
  6. Recruitment and Hiring Practices:

    • Diverse Candidate Sourcing: Actively source diverse candidates for job openings through diverse recruitment channels and partnerships.
    • Structured Interview Processes: Implement structured interview processes to minimize biases during candidate evaluations. Train hiring managers on inclusive hiring practices.
  7. Promotion of Inclusive Leadership:

    • Leadership Development Programs: Offer leadership development programs that emphasize the importance of inclusive leadership. Provide tools and resources for leaders to foster diverse and collaborative teams.
    • Inclusive Decision-Making: Encourage leaders to incorporate diverse perspectives into decision-making processes. This includes seeking input from employees with various backgrounds and experiences.
  8. Flexible Work Policies:

    • Work-Life Balance Initiatives: Implement flexible work policies that support work-life balance, accommodate diverse needs, and foster an inclusive workplace for employees with varying responsibilities.
    • Remote Work Options: Consider remote work options to provide flexibility for employees with different circumstances.
  9. Fair Compensation Practices:

    • Pay Equity Assessments: Regularly assess and address pay equity within the organization to ensure that all employees receive fair compensation for their roles.
    • Transparency: Foster transparency in compensation practices, helping build trust and ensuring that employees understand the criteria used for pay decisions.
  10. Supplier Diversity Programs:

    • Diverse Supplier Networks: Establish programs that support and prioritize partnerships with diverse suppliers. Promoting diversity in the supply chain contributes to broader economic inclusion.
    • Supplier Diversity Goals: Set goals for increasing the representation of minority-owned, women-owned, and other diverse businesses within the organization’s supplier network.
  11. Inclusive Employee Benefits:

    • Comprehensive Benefits: Review and enhance employee benefits to ensure they are inclusive and meet the diverse needs of the workforce. This may include family-friendly policies, healthcare options, and mental health support.
    • Employee Assistance Programs: Provide resources and assistance programs that address the unique challenges faced by diverse employees.
  12. Community Engagement and Social Responsibility:

    • Community Partnerships: Engage with and support local communities to contribute to social responsibility initiatives that align with diversity and inclusion goals.
    • Public Commitments: Make public commitments to diversity and inclusion, communicating the organization’s dedication to making a positive impact beyond its internal operations.
  13. Regular Audits and Assessments:

    • Regular Diversity Audits: Conduct regular audits of diversity and inclusion initiatives to assess their effectiveness. Use the findings to make data-driven decisions and adjust strategies as needed.
    • External Audits: Consider external audits or third-party assessments to provide an unbiased evaluation of the organization’s diversity and inclusion practices.
  14. Celebrate Diversity and Inclusion Milestones:

    • Recognition Programs: Establish recognition programs to celebrate achievements related to diversity and inclusion. Acknowledge individuals and teams that contribute significantly to fostering an inclusive culture.
    • Awareness Campaigns: Conduct awareness campaigns to highlight diverse cultural celebrations, important historical events, and awareness months.
  15. Legal Compliance:

    • Stay Informed: Stay informed about and compliant with relevant diversity and inclusion laws and regulations. Regularly update policies and practices to align with legal requirements.
    • Legal Consultation: Seek legal advice to ensure that diversity and inclusion initiatives are in accordance with local and international laws.
  16. Communication and Transparency:

    • Clear Communication: Communicate the organization’s diversity and inclusion goals, progress, and initiatives clearly and consistently across all levels of the organization.
    • Transparency: Be transparent about the organization’s commitment to diversity and inclusion, sharing successes, challenges, and future plans with employees.
  17. Continuous Improvement:

    • Feedback Loops: Establish feedback loops that allow employees to provide input on diversity and inclusion initiatives. Use this feedback to continuously improve and refine strategies.
    • Adaptability: Recognize that diversity and inclusion efforts may need to evolve over time to address changing organizational needs and societal expectations.
  18. Integration with Performance Metrics:

    • Performance Evaluation Metrics: Integrate diversity and inclusion metrics into performance evaluations for leaders and managers. Hold individuals accountable for contributing to a diverse and inclusive workplace.
    • Inclusive Success Metrics: Consider metrics beyond traditional diversity statistics, such as measuring the success of inclusive leadership behaviors, employee engagement, and the impact of initiatives on organizational culture.
  19. Global Considerations:

    • Cultural Sensitivity: Adapt diversity and inclusion initiatives to account for cultural differences in various regions where the organization operates.
    • Local Partnerships: Establish partnerships with local organizations and community groups to better understand and address diversity challenges in different global contexts.
  20. Investment in Technology:

    • Diversity Analytics Tools: Leverage technology, including analytics tools, to collect and analyze diversity and inclusion data. This information can guide decision-making and help measure the impact of initiatives.
    • Training Platforms: Utilize online platforms for delivering diversity and inclusion training, making resources easily accessible to employees in different locations.

Remember, the effectiveness of diversity and inclusion initiatives depends on ongoing commitment, continuous improvement, and the integration of these strategies into the fabric of the organization. Regularly reassess the landscape, listen to employee feedback, and adapt initiatives to ensure they remain relevant and impactful.
